The National Institute of Design Andhra Pradesh is established in September 2015 as an autonomous Institute under the DPIIT, Ministry of Commerce and Industry, Government of India. It is situated temporarily in Acharya Nagarjuna University on Guntur - Vijayawada highway (NH 16) as a transit campus before moving to permanent campus to come up in 50 acres site in Amravati, new Capital City of Andhra Pradesh. NID Andhra Pradesh currently offers full-time four year Bachelor of Design (B. Des. ). With specialisation streams of
1. INDUSTRIAL DESIGN,
2. COMMUNICATION DESIGN and

Yes, you can pursue the M.Des course at NID on the basis of 4 years GDPD courses. GDPD course is a Diploma level course. While B. Des is an Undergraduate level degree course. The eligibility criteria and course duration are the same for both courses. Fee structure is also a big difference between the both of courses. The fee details of both of courses are given below.
1. B. Des Course fee : Rs 1207800 (Excluding hostel charges)
2. GDPD Course fee : Rs 953200 (NID Andhra Pradesh) Excluding hostel charges.
